The inductance of a closely packed coil of 300 turns is 6.00×10-3 H. Calculate the magnetic flux through the coil when the current is 4.00×10-3 A.

Explanation / Answer

N*phi = flux linkage

N*phi = L*i

phi = L*i/N

L = 6 x 10^-3 H

i = 4 x 10^-3 A

N = 300

phi = 8 x 10^-8 Wb
